There is no IC available for the T flip flop. Generally, it is modified from the JK flip flop. The most common IC used to make T flip flop is MC74HC73A (Dual JK Flip Flop). T flip flop can be derived from JK, SR, and D flip flop. The easiest way to construct a T flip flop is from a JK flip flop. WebIf you replace JA and KA in the equation for QA (t+1), you will get: QA (t+1) = (QA (t)' AND QB (t)) + (QA (t) AND QB (t)') = QA (t) XOR QB (t) So the fastest way to compute QA (t+1) is that you would toggle QA (t) whenever QB (t)==1 and leave QA (t) unchanged whenever QB (t)==0.
